Connecting the Spray Wand to the Trigger
(Cat. No. 49-16-28PS, 49-16-28CS)
11
1. Insert the spray wand into the trigger
handle (1) until firmly seated.
2. Slide the nut onto the threaded coupling
and hand tighten securely (2).
3. Pull on the spray wand to be certain it is
properly secured.
4. Place the assembled trigger handle and
12
wand into one of the wand storage loca-
tions.

Connecting Water Supply or Nozzle
26
To attach water supply hose to the tool or
nozzle, push the quick connect fitting and
27
tool/nozzle together (1). Pull on the connec-
tion to be certain it is properly secured. To
remove, pull the collar back to release (2).
When using the nozzle, adjust spray pattern
as desired by tightening/loosening the noz-
zle.
